Overview
Provides new mechanical designs of microinjectors, microsyringes, microgrippers, and microforce sensors with experimental verifications
Presents new position and force control of the microinjection systems for biological cell microinjection
Examples give the reader more practice in the design, modeling, and control of biological micromanipulation systems
